Aquil Roshan 发布的文章

Ubuntu 的制造商 Canonical 早已和微软进行合作,让我们体验了极具争议的 Bash on Windows。外界对此也是褒贬不一,许多 Linux 重度用户则是质疑其是否有用,以及更进一步认为 Bash on Windows 是一个安全隐患

Unix 的 Bash 是通过 WSL ( Windows 的 Linux 子系统 Windows Subsystem for Linux ) 特性移植到了 Windows 中。早先,我们已经展示过 安装 Bash 到 Windows

Canonical 和微软合作的 Bash on Windows 也仅仅是 Ubuntu 的命令行而已,并非是正规的图形用户界面。

不过,有个好现象是 Linux 爱好者开始在上面投入时间和精力,他们在 WSL 做到的成绩甚至让最初的开发者都吃惊,“等等,这真的可以吗?”。

这个正在逐步实现之中。

没错,上图所示就是运行在 Windows 中的 Ubuntu Unity 桌面。一位名为 Pablo Gonzalez (GitHub ID 为 Guerra24 )的程序员将这个完美实现了。随着这个实现,他向我们展示了 WSL 已经超越了当初构想之时的功能。

如果现在可以在 Windows 子系统之中运行 Ubuntu Unity,那么运行其他的 Linux 发行版还会远吗?

Arch Linux 版的 Bash on Windows

在 WSL 本地运行完整的 Linux发行版,迟早是要实现的。而我最希望的就是 Arch LinuxAntergos 爱好者点击此处)。

Hold 住,Hold 住,该项目目前还在测试中。它由“mintxomat”在 GitHub 上开发的,最新为 0.6 版本。第一个稳定版将在今年的 12 月底发布。

那么,该项目的出台会有什么不同呢?

你可能早就知道,WSL 仅在 Windows 10 中可用。但是 Windows 的 Linux 子系统之 Arch Linux (AWSL) 早已成功的运行在 Windows 7、Windows 8、Windows 8.1 和 Windows Server 2012(R2),当然还有 Windows 10。

我靠,他们是怎么做到的?!

其开发者曾说,AWSL 协议抽象归纳了不同 Windows 版本的各种框架。所以,当 AWSL 发布 1.0 应该会取得更大的成绩。如我们之前提到的移植性,该项目会先向所有 Windows 版本推出 Bash on Windows。

该项目很有雄心,并且很有看头。如果等不及 12 月底的稳定版,你可以先行尝试其测试版。但要记住,目前还是开发者预览版,此刻并不稳定。但是,我们什么时候停止过折腾的脚步?

你也可到 GitHub 查看此项目的进度:Arch on Windows Subsystem

分享本文,以便大家都知道 Arch Linux 即将登陆 Windows 子系统。同时,也告诉我们,你希望 WSL 中有什么发行版。


via: https://itsfoss.com/arch-linux-windows-subsystem/

作者:Aquil Roshan 译者:GHLandy 校对:wxy

本文由 LCTT 原创编译,Linux中国 荣誉推出

多数的的桌面 Linux 用户都会选择三种发行版本:Debian/Ubuntu、Fedora 或者 Arch Linux。但是今天,我将给出你需要使用 openSUSE 的五大理由。

相比其他的 Linux 发行版,我总能在 openSUSE 上看到一些令人耳目一新的东西。我说不太好,但它总是如此的闪亮和个性鲜明。这绿色的大蜥蜴是看起来如此的令人惊叹!但这并不是 openSUSE 即便不是最好也是要比其它发行版更好的原因!

请别误解我。我在各种场合用过许多不同的 Linux 发行版,同时也很敬佩在这些发行版背后默默工作的开发者,是他们让计算变成一件快乐的事情。但是 openSUSE 一直让人感觉,嗯,令人崇敬——你是不是也这样觉得?

openSUSE 比其他 Linux 发行版要好的五大理由

你是不是认为我在说 openSUSE 是最好的 Linux 发行版?不,我并不是要表达这个意思。其实没有任何一个 Linux 发行版是最好的。它真的可以满足你寻找 “灵魂伴侣” 的需求。

但在这里,我准备给大家说说,openSUSE 比其他发行版做得要好的五件事。如下:

1 社区规则

openSUSE 是一个典型的社区驱动型项目。我经常看到很多用户在升级后抱怨开发人员改变了他们喜欢的发行版。但在 openSUSE 不是这样,openSUSE 是纯社区驱动的项目,并且任何时候都朝着用户所希望的方向发展。

2 系统的健壮性

另外一个是操作系统的集成程度。我可以在同一个 openSUSE 系统上安装所有的最好的 Linux 桌面环境,而在 Ubuntu 上则因为系统的稳定性,坚决不允许用户这样做。而这恰好体现了一个系统的健壮程度。因此,对于那些喜欢自己动手完成每一件事的用户,openSUSE 还是很诱人的。

3 易于安装软件

在 Linux 的世界里有很多非常好用的包管理工具。从 Debian 的 apt-get 到 Fedora 的 DNF,它们无不吸引着用户,而且在这些发行版成为流行版本的过程中扮演着重要角色。

openSUSE 同样有一个将软件传递到桌面的好方法。software.opensuse.org 是一个 Web 界面,你可以用它从仓库中获取安装软件。你所需要做的就是打开这个链接 (当然,是在 openSUSE 系统上),在搜索框中输入你想要的软件,点击“直接安装”即可。就是这么简单,不是吗?

听起来就像是在使用 Google 商店一样,是吗?

4 YAST

毫不夸张的说,YaST (LCTT 译注: YaST 是 openSUSE 和 SUSE Linux 企业版的安装和配置工具) 绝对是世界上有史以来操作系统上最好的控制中心。并且毫无疑问地,你可以使用它来操控系统上的一切:网络、软件升级以及所有的基础设置等。无论是 openSUSE 的个人版或是 SUSE Linux 企业版,你都能在 YaST 的强力支撑下,轻松的完成安装。总之,一个工具,方便而无所不能。

5 开箱即用的极致体验

SUSE 的团队是 Linux 内核中最大的贡献者团体之一。他们辛勤的努力也意味着,他们有足够的经验来应付不同的硬件条件。

有着良好的硬件支持,一定会有很棒的开箱即用的体验。

6 他们做了一些搞笑视频

等等,不是说好了是五个理由吗?怎么多了一个!

但因为 Abhishek 逼着我加进来,因为他们做的 Linux 的搞笑视频才使 openSUSE 成为了最好的发行版。

开了个玩笑,不过还是看看 Uptime Funk,你将会知道为什么 SUSE 是最酷的 Linux

LEAP 还是 TUMBLEWEED?该用哪一个!

如果你现在想要使用 openSUSE 了,让我来告诉你,这两个 openSUSE 版本:LEAP 和 TUMBLEWEED。哪一个更合适你一点。

尽管两者都提供了相似的体验和相似的环境,但还是需要你自行决定安装那个版本到你硬盘上。

OPENSUSE : LEAP

openSUSE Leap 是一个普通的大众版本,基本上每八个月更新一次。目前最新的版本是 openSUSE 42.1。它所有的软件都是稳定版,给用户提供最顺畅的体验。

对于家庭用户、办公和商业用户,是再合适不过的了。它合适那些想要一个稳定系统,而不必事事亲为,可以让他们安心工作的用户。只要进行正确的设置之后,你就不必担心其他事情,然后专心投入工作就好。同时,我也强烈建议图书馆和学校使用 Leap。

OPENSUSE: TUMBLEWEED

Tumbleweed version of openSUSE 是滚动式更新的版本。它定期更新系统中所使用的软件集的最新版本。对于想要使用最新软件以及想向 openSUSE 做出贡献的开发者和高级用户来说,这个版本绝对值得一试。

需要指出的是,Tumbleweed 并不是 Leap 的 beta 和 测试版本 。它是最新锐的 Linux 稳定发行版。

Tumbleweed 给了你最快的更新,但是仅在开发者确定某个包的稳定性之后才行。

说说你的想法?

请在下方评论说出你对 openSUSE 的想法。如果你已经在考虑使用 openSUSE,你更想用 Leap 和 Tumbleweed 哪一个版本呢?

来,让我们开干!


via: https://itsfoss.com/why-use-opensuse/

作者:Aquil Roshan 译者:GHLandy 校对:wxy

本文由 LCTT 原创编译,Linux中国 荣誉推出

作为一个活跃的 Linux 爱好者,我经常向我的朋友们介绍 Linux,帮助他们选择最适合他们的发行版本,同时也会帮助他们安装一些适用于他们工作的开源软件。

但是在这一次,我就变得很无奈。我的叔叔,他是一个自由职业的会计师。他会有一系列的为了会计工作的漂亮而成熟的付费软件。我不那么确定我能在在开源软件中找到这么一款可以替代的软件——直到昨天。

Abhishek 给我推荐了一些很酷的软件,而其中 GNU Khata 脱颖而出。

GNU Khata 是一个会计工具。 或者,我应该说成是一系列的会计工具集合?它就像经济管理方面的 Evernote 一样。它的应用是如此之广,以至于它不但可以用于个人的财务管理,也可以用于大型公司的管理,从店铺存货管理到税率计算,都可以有效处理。

有个有趣的地方,Khata 这个词在印度或者是其他的印度语国家中意味着账户,所以这个会计软件叫做 GNU Khata。

安装

互联网上有很多关于旧的 Web 版本的 Khata 安装介绍。现在,GNU Khata 只能用在 Debian/Ubuntu 和它们的衍生版本中。我建议你按照 GNU Khata 官网给出的如下步骤来安装。我们来快速过一下。

  • 这里下载安装器。
  • 在下载目录打开终端。
  • 粘贴复制以下的代码到终端,并且执行。
sudo chmod 755 GNUKhatasetup.run
sudo ./GNUKhatasetup.run

这就结束了,从你的 Dash 或者是应用菜单中启动 GNU Khata 吧。

第一次启动

GNU Khata 在浏览器中打开,并且展现以下的画面。

填写组织的名字、组织形式,财务年度并且点击 proceed 按钮进入管理设置页面。

仔细填写你的用户名、密码、安全问题及其答案,并且点击“create and login”。

你已经全部设置完成了。使用菜单栏来开始使用 GNU Khata 来管理你的财务吧。这很容易。

移除 GNU KHATA

如果你不想使用 GNU Khata 了,你可以执行如下命令移除:

sudo apt-get remove --auto-remove gnukhata-core-engine

你也可以通过新立得软件管理来删除它。

GNU KHATA 真的是市面上付费会计应用的竞争对手吗?

首先,GNU Khata 以简化为设计原则。顶部的菜单栏组织的很方便,可以帮助你有效的进行工作。你可以选择管理不同的账户和项目,并且切换非常容易。它们的官网表明,GNU Khata 可以“像说印度语一样方便”(LCTT 译注:原谅我,这个软件作者和本文作者是印度人……)。同时,你知道 GNU Khata 也可以在云端使用吗?

所有的主流的账户管理工具,比如分类账簿、项目报表、财务报表等等都用专业的方式整理,并且支持自定义格式和即时展示。这让会计和仓储管理看起来如此的简单。

这个项目正在积极的发展,正在寻求实操中的反馈以帮助这个软件更加进步。考虑到软件的成熟性、使用的便利性还有免费的情况,GNU Khata 可能会成为你最好的账簿助手。

请在评论框里留言吧,让我们知道你是如何看待 GNU Khata 的。


via: https://itsfoss.com/using-gnu-khata/

作者:Aquil Roshan 译者:MikeCoder 校对:wxy

本文由 LCTT 原创编译,Linux中国 荣誉推出